Believing in the trinity doesn't save nor does not believing the trinity mean you are unsaved, but it is an important doctrine that is crucial to understanding who our savior Jesus is.
Isaiah 9:6
For a child will be born to us, a son will be given to us; And the government will rest on His shoulders; And His name will be called Wonderful Counselor, Mighty God, Eternal Father, Prince of Peace.
John 1:1
In the beginning was the Word, and the Word was with God, and the Word was God.
John 1:14
And the Word became flesh, and dwelt among us, and we saw His glory, glory as of the only begotten from the Father, full of grace and truth.
Exodus 3:14
God said to Moses, "I AM WHO I AM"; and He said, "Thus you shall say to the sons of Israel, 'I AM has sent me to you.'"
John 8:58
Jesus said to them, “Truly, truly, I say to you, before Abraham was born, I am.”
Deuteronomy 6:4
"Hear, O Israel! The LORD is our God, the LORD is one!
John 10:30
"I and the Father are one."
John 20:28
Thomas answered and said to Him, "My Lord and my God!"
